Design and Build

The Keurig K-Duo boasts a sleek and compact design that fits seamlessly into any kitchen countertop. The device measures 12 inches wide, 10 inches deep, and 13.5 inches tall, making it an excellent space-saving option for small kitchens or offices.

The exterior is made of durable plastic with a matte finish, giving it a premium look and feel. The control panel is intuitive and easy to navigate, featuring a large LCD display that shows the current settings and allows users to customize their brewing preferences.

Key Features

One of the standout features of the Keurig K-Duo is its ability to brew both single-serve cups and full carafes. This versatility makes it an excellent choice for households with multiple coffee drinkers, as each person can have their own personalized cup without having to wait for a whole pot to finish brewing.

The machine also comes equipped with a range of customizable settings, including:

  • Temperature control: Users can adjust the temperature to suit their preferred brewing style, ranging from 195°F to 205°F.
  • Strength adjustment: The Keurig K-Duo allows users to choose between three different strength levels for their coffee, ensuring that it’s tailored to their taste preferences.
  • Water reservoir: A removable and refillable water tank holds up to 60 ounces of water, providing a generous supply for both single-serve cups and carafes.

Brewing Performance

The Keurig K-Duo uses proprietary K-Cup technology, which ensures consistent results across a wide range of coffee brands. Users can choose from over 400 different K-Cups to suit their taste preferences, or opt for ground coffee using the machine’s built-in filter basket.

In terms of brewing performance, the Keurig K-Duo delivers impressive results. The single-serve cups are filled quickly and consistently, while the carafe brews a full pot in just over 5 minutes.

Additional Features

The Keurig K-Duo also comes with several additional features that enhance its overall usability and convenience:

  • Auto-shutoff: The machine automatically turns off after a set period of inactivity to conserve energy.
  • Removable drip tray: Users can easily clean the drip tray by removing it from the device and washing it under running water.
  • Quiet operation: The Keurig K-Duo operates at a relatively low decibel level, making it suitable for use in offices or homes.

Technical Specifications:

  • Dimensions: 12 inches wide x 10 inches deep x 13.5 inches tall
  • Weight: 13 pounds
  • Brewing temperature range: 195°F – 205°F
  • Strength adjustment options: Three levels (mild, medium, strong)
  • Water reservoir capacity: Up to 60 ounces
  • K-Cup compatibility: Over 400 different flavors and brands
  • Carafe brewing capacity: Up to 12 cups
  • Power consumption: 1100 watts (auto-shutoff after 2 hours of inactivity)
